Authentic Moments is a show where we share ideas and strategies for personal growth in the practice of parenting. As we raise our children, we grow ourselves. We talk about the importance of being trauma-informed, making sense of our stories, breaking free from our patterns and triggers, finding our authentic voice in parenting, living our truth, befriending our emotions, managing stress, cultivating self-compassion, and mindfulness. It is by gaining deeper self- knowledge, raising our self-awareness, elevating our consciousness, getting closer to our authentic self that we support our children on that very same process of self discovery.     SHOW NOTES: In this episode host, parent educator Anna Seewald and guest, award-winning parenting author, speaker and the mother of four children Ann Douglas talk about raising a child with a psychological condition. How to Handle the Highs, the Lows, and Everything in Between. Ann Douglas knows firsthand just how daunting it can be—and what a difference knowledge and support can make. Each of her four children (now grown and thriving) has dealt with one or more mental health challenges, and Douglas shares what she has learned about coping with the emotional roller coaster, finding the best treatments, helping kids manage their symptoms and succeed academically, and keeping the family strong. Parenting Through the Storm is a guide to parenting a child who is struggling with a mental health, neurodevelopment, or behavioral challenge.
